Spiro Expands Electric Mobility in Ogun State with 1,000 New Bikes
Bennett Oghifo
Spiro, Africa’s leading provider of electric mobility solutions and battery swapping technology, has expanded its operations in Ogun State with the deployment of 1,000 new electric bikes.
The fleet was officially inaugurated at the Gateway International Airport by President Bola Ahmed Tinubu (GCFR) and the Governor of Ogun State, Prince Dapo Abiodun (CON) last week.
According to Spiro, this landmark initiative represents a major step forward in advancing sustainable transportation across Nigeria.
By reducing carbon emissions and offering affordable alternatives to fuel-powered vehicles, Spiro is supporting the government’s vision of a cleaner and greener environment.
“With rising fuel costs, our electric bikes provide a cost-effective solution for riders, passengers, and businesses,” said Kaushik Burman, CEO of Spiro. “We are proud to partner with both the Ogun State Government and the Federal Government to deliver eco-friendly mobility that empowers Nigerians to improve their livelihoods while protecting the environment.”
Governor Abiodun says the Spiro electric bikes will mitigate the sudden increase in fuel prices.
